What is Slope and Why is it Important?

Slope, in its simplest form, describes the steepness of a line. It's a measure of how much the vertical position (rise) changes for every unit change in the horizontal position (run). Mathematically, slope (often represented by 'm') is calculated as the ratio of the vertical change to the horizontal change between any two points on a line. A positive slope indicates an upward trend, a negative slope indicates a downward trend, a slope of zero represents a horizontal line, and an undefined slope represents a vertical line.

The Rise Over Run Method: A Visual Approach to Slope

The "Rise Over Run" method provides a highly intuitive and visual way to understand and calculate slope. It leverages the inherent geometric properties of a line to represent the concept in a concrete manner. Instead of simply applying a formula, students are guided to identify the vertical change (rise) and the horizontal change (run) between two points on a line directly from a graph. This visual representation helps students make the connection between the abstract concept of slope and its concrete manifestation on a graph.

The method typically involves drawing a right-angled triangle on the graph, using the two points as vertices. The vertical leg of the triangle represents the rise, and the horizontal leg represents the run. By counting the units along each leg, students can easily calculate the slope as rise/run. This simple yet effective technique bridges the gap between abstract mathematical concepts and concrete graphical representation, enhancing comprehension and retention.

Types of Rise Over Run Worksheets and Their Applications

Rise Over Run worksheets come in a variety of formats, catering to different learning styles and skill levels. Some worksheets focus solely on calculating slope from a graph, while others incorporate equations of lines or require students to plot points based on given slopes. More advanced worksheets might introduce the concept of parallel and perpendicular lines, further developing students’ understanding of slope’s relationship to line geometry.

Basic worksheets often feature simple graphs with clearly marked points, while more challenging ones include graphs with less clearly defined points, forcing students to estimate coordinates. Some worksheets also incorporate real-world applications, such as calculating the slope of a roof or the incline of a hill. This context-based approach helps students understand the practical relevance of slope and its applicability beyond the classroom. Interactive online worksheets and apps further enhance the learning experience, allowing for immediate feedback and personalized practice.

Benefits and Challenges of Using Rise Over Run Worksheets

The benefits of using Rise Over Run worksheets are numerous. They provide a visual and engaging way to learn about slope, improving comprehension and retention. They promote active learning through hands-on practice and encourage students to connect abstract concepts to real-world applications. The adaptability of these worksheets allows for differentiated instruction, ensuring that all students can learn at their own pace and level.

However, there are also some challenges. Some students may still struggle with the concept of slope, even with the visual aid of a Rise Over Run worksheet. The effectiveness of these worksheets also depends heavily on the teacher's ability to effectively explain the concept and provide support. For students with limited spatial reasoning skills, the visual aspect of the method may not be as effective. Furthermore, reliance solely on Rise Over Run worksheets might neglect the importance of algebraic approaches to calculating slopes, potentially limiting a student's overall understanding of the concept.
